15 Nov 2009, 9:58 AM
I want to specify a 10px padding in a viewport all the way around. However, it only seems to be applying the padding for X and Y, but not Right and Bottom. Here is the code:

vp = new Ext.Viewport({
layout: "fit",
style: {
padding: "10px 10px 10px 10px"
var container = new Ext.Panel({


The panel (container) is padded 10px from X and Y of the viewport, but not the bottom in FireFox and both bottom and right in IE6.

Is this a bug??

26 Feb 2010, 1:18 AM
Youn have to introduce style in items section of viiew port.


Ext.BLANK_IMAGE_URL = '/javascripts/ext-3.1.0/resources/images/default/s.gif';
viewport = new Ext.Viewport({
title:'Test App'
,items:[{xtype:'panel', border:false, style:'padding:10px', html:'test'}]